Job description

Balchem is committed to making the world a healthier place by delivering trusted, innovative, and science-based solutions for the health and nutritional needs of the world. Balchem employs approximately 1,400 employees worldwide who provide the service, quality, and technology that enables our customers to win with their customers. We have built a reputation for delivering results to all of our stakeholders. Founded in 1967, Balchem, a Maryland corporation, became a publicly-traded company in 1970 and is listed on Nasdaq under the symbol “BCPC.” Our corporate headquarters is located in Montvale, New Jersey, and we have a broad network of sales offices, manufacturing sites, and R&D centers, primarily located in the U.S. and Europe. The Company consists of three business segments: Human Nutrition and Health, Animal Nutrition and Health, and Specialty Products.

POSITION SUMMARY:

The Service Desk Technician serves as the first point of contact for resolving hardware, software, desktop, laptop, printer, and peripheral issues. This role provides routine and urgent support to end users, including identifying, researching, documenting, tracking, and resolving problems to ensure timely closure. The technician is responsible for owning support calls, escalating priority issues when appropriate, and explaining technical concepts in clear, non-technical language. Success in this role requires sound independent judgment, frequent collaboration with end users, peers, and managers, a positive attitude, and a strong team-oriented approach.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
  • Serve as the initial point of contact for employee support requests in person, by phone, and through the Service Desk ticketing system.
  • Troubleshoot, research, and resolve hardware, software, application, printer, peripheral, and network-related issues; document solutions for future reference.
  • Install, configure, maintain, and upgrade desktops, laptops, printers, software, and related end-user technology.
  • Assist with the maintenance of servers, Ethernet networks, cabling, and other IT infrastructure, equipment, and systems.
  • Follow standard Service Desk procedures, accurately log and track requests, maintain ownership of issues, and ensure timely resolution or escalation.
  • Communicate technical information clearly to non-technical users and advise employees on appropriate courses of action.
  • Collaborate with vendors and internal IT teams to resolve issues, support product enhancements, and assist with major system changes, network redesigns, and systems integrations.
  • Develop a working knowledge of commonly used software, hardware, equipment, and the interdependencies among systems, applications, and infrastructure.
  • Assist with documenting recurring issues, resolutions, and best practices to support knowledge sharing and continuous improvement.
  • Follow all safety policies and procedures, including the use of required personal protective equipment and equipment safeguards.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
REQUIREMENTS:
  • Associate degree and/or relevant professional IT certification, such as CompTIA or Google IT Support.
  • Ability to build rapport with employees and gather clear, accurate details about technical issues.
  • Working knowledge of computer troubleshooting for Windows-based devices and mobile device troubleshooting for iOS and Android.
  • Familiarity with Microsoft Office, Windows 11, ticketing systems, internal documentation platforms, and remote management tools.
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ills, including the ability to explain technical information to non-technical users.
  • Ability to organize resources, manage priorities, and follow through on assigned tasks.
  • Ability to learn, install, configure, and maintain various computer hardware and software systems
  • Passion for technology, eagerness to learn, and a growth-oriented mindset focused on continuously developing technical skills and advancing within the IT field.
  • Ability to work weekends or late evenings as needed to support business and system requirements.
P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S:
  • Ability to lift and transport equipment up to 50 lbs.
  • Comfort working on ladders, in ceilings, under tables, and in various room setups.

The expected hourly rate for this postion is $23 - $28 an hour.
